How Can I Easily Transfer My OS to an SSD?
Upgrading your computer’s storage by transferring your operating system (OS) to a solid-state drive (SSD) is one of the smartest moves you can make to boost performance and speed. Whether you’re tired of slow boot times, lagging applications, or simply want to breathe new life into an aging machine, moving your OS to an SSD can transform your computing experience. But the process might seem daunting if you’re unfamiliar with the steps involved or worried about losing important data.
Transferring an OS to an SSD involves more than just plugging in a new drive—it requires careful planning, the right tools, and a clear understanding of how to migrate your system without disrupting your workflow. From cloning your existing installation to ensuring compatibility and optimizing settings, there are several considerations to keep in mind. This guide will walk you through the essentials, helping you make a seamless transition that maximizes the benefits of your new SSD.
Whether you’re a seasoned tech enthusiast or a beginner eager to improve your PC’s speed, understanding the fundamentals of OS transfer is key. By the end of this article, you’ll be equipped with the knowledge to confidently move your operating system to an SSD, unlocking faster startup times, improved reliability, and a more responsive computing environment.
Preparing Your System and SSD for Transfer
Before initiating the transfer of your operating system to an SSD, it is crucial to prepare both your current system and the new drive properly. This preparation ensures a smooth migration process and helps avoid common pitfalls that could lead to data loss or boot issues.
First, verify that your SSD has sufficient storage capacity to accommodate the entire OS and any essential system files. The used space on your existing drive should be less than or equal to the available space on the SSD. It is recommended to clean up unnecessary files, uninstall unused applications, and perform disk cleanup to reduce the amount of data that needs transferring.
Next, back up all important data from your current drive. Although cloning processes are generally safe, unexpected errors or interruptions may cause data loss. Creating a full backup or system image allows you to recover quickly if needed.
It is also advisable to update your current operating system to the latest version and ensure all device drivers are up to date. This can prevent compatibility issues during or after the transfer.
Physically, connect the SSD to your computer. For desktops, this often involves installing the SSD internally via SATA or NVMe interfaces. For laptops, you might use a USB-to-SATA adapter or an external enclosure if only one drive bay is available.
Finally, check your BIOS/UEFI settings. Enable AHCI mode for SATA drives to optimize SSD performance and ensure the system recognizes the new hardware. You may also need to configure boot priority after the transfer to boot from the SSD.
Cloning the Operating System to the SSD
Cloning is the process of creating an exact, bit-for-bit copy of your current OS drive onto the SSD. This method preserves the system’s configuration, installed applications, and user data, allowing you to boot directly from the SSD without reinstalling the OS.
Many software tools facilitate cloning, including free and commercial options. Popular choices include:
- Macrium Reflect
- Acronis True Image
- EaseUS Todo Backup
- Clonezilla
When selecting a tool, ensure it supports your OS version and SSD type.
The general cloning process involves:
- Launching the cloning software and selecting the current OS drive as the source.
- Choosing the SSD as the destination drive.
- Opting for sector-by-sector cloning if you want an exact replica, or file-level cloning to copy only used data.
- Confirming the operation and starting the clone.
Be aware that the SSD will be overwritten during this process, so any existing data on it will be erased.
Adjusting System Settings Post-Transfer
After cloning, some adjustments are necessary to optimize the system for the SSD’s characteristics. These changes can improve performance and extend the SSD’s lifespan.
Disable disk defragmentation, as SSDs do not benefit from it and excessive defragmentation can reduce their longevity. Most modern OS versions automatically detect SSDs and disable defragmentation, but it’s worth verifying manually.
Enable TRIM support, which allows the OS to inform the SSD which blocks of data are no longer considered in use and can be wiped internally. TRIM helps maintain SSD performance over time.
Adjust virtual memory settings if needed, as SSDs provide faster access times, but excessive paging can still wear the drive.
Verify that the system boots from the SSD by entering BIOS/UEFI settings and setting the SSD as the primary boot device. Remove or disconnect the original OS drive to prevent boot conflicts, if desired.
Comparison of Cloning and Fresh Installation Methods
Choosing between cloning your existing OS and performing a fresh installation depends on your specific needs, time constraints, and the current state of your system. The table below summarizes key differences:
Aspect | Cloning | Fresh Installation |
---|---|---|
Time Required | Typically faster; depends on data size | Longer; requires OS installation and setup |
Preserves Installed Programs | Yes, all programs and settings remain intact | No, programs must be reinstalled |
Potential for Transferring Errors | Possible, especially if the source drive has issues | Minimal; clean state reduces errors |
System Optimization | May require manual adjustments post-cloning | Optimized by default during installation |
Data Backup Requirement | Recommended but not mandatory if cloning software is reliable | Essential to avoid data loss |
Preparing for the OS Transfer
Before initiating the transfer of your operating system (OS) to a solid-state drive (SSD), thorough preparation is crucial to ensure a smooth and successful migration. This involves hardware readiness, software tools, and data backup.
Check SSD Compatibility and Capacity
- Verify that the SSD has sufficient storage capacity for the current OS installation, including system files, applications, and user data.
- Ensure the SSD supports the interface of your motherboard (e.g., SATA, NVMe) for optimal performance.
- Update the system BIOS or UEFI firmware to the latest version to enhance compatibility with new drives.
Backup Critical Data
Backing up your data is essential to prevent loss during the cloning or migration process. Use one or more of the following methods:
- External hard drives or cloud storage services for full backups.
- System restore points or disk imaging software for incremental backup.
- Verification of backup integrity before proceeding with migration.
Choose Appropriate Migration Software
OS transfer typically requires cloning or migration software that can replicate your existing system onto the SSD. Common choices include:
Software | Key Features | Compatibility |
---|---|---|
Macrium Reflect | Disk cloning, imaging, incremental backups | Windows |
Samsung Data Migration | Optimized for Samsung SSDs, easy cloning | Windows |
Acronis True Image | Comprehensive disk cloning, backup, and recovery | Windows, Mac |
Clonezilla | Open-source cloning, supports many file systems | Cross-platform |
Always ensure that the software supports your current OS version and file system.
Cloning the Operating System to the SSD
Cloning the OS involves creating an exact copy of your current system partition onto the SSD, enabling you to boot from the new drive without reinstalling the OS or applications.
Step-by-Step Cloning Process
- Connect the SSD: Attach the SSD to your computer via SATA cable or M.2 slot, depending on the form factor.
- Initialize the SSD: Use disk management tools to initialize the SSD with the GPT partition style if your system uses UEFI, or MBR if it uses BIOS.
- Launch the Migration Software: Open your chosen cloning tool and select the source disk (your current OS drive) and the destination disk (the SSD).
- Configure Cloning Options: Choose to clone all partitions or only system-related partitions. Enable options such as “Optimize for SSD” if available.
- Start the Cloning Process: Confirm and begin the cloning. This may take from several minutes to a few hours depending on data size.
- Verify Completion: Upon completion, safely disconnect or eject the SSD if desired.
Important Considerations:
- Ensure the target SSD has no critical data as cloning will overwrite it.
- Deactivate or uninstall any disk encryption temporarily to avoid cloning issues.
- Do not interrupt the cloning process to prevent corruption.
Configuring the System to Boot from the SSD
After cloning, the system must be configured to boot from the new SSD for the OS transfer to be effective.
Modify Boot Order in BIOS/UEFI
- Restart the computer and enter BIOS/UEFI setup (commonly by pressing Del, F2, or F12 during startup).
- Navigate to the Boot menu and locate the boot priority or boot device order.
- Set the SSD as the first boot device.
- Save changes and exit the BIOS/UEFI interface.
Verify Successful Boot
Upon reboot, the system should load the OS from the SSD. Confirm this by:
- Checking drive information in the system settings or disk management tool to ensure the boot partition is on the SSD.
- Observing improved system responsiveness and faster boot times indicative of SSD operation.
Additional Steps
- If the system fails to boot, review BIOS settings for legacy/UEFI compatibility.
- Run a startup repair from the installation media if boot files are corrupted.
- Consider using disk management tools to mark the SSD’s system partition as active.
Optimizing the SSD for Operating System Performance
To maximize the longevity and performance of your SSD after transferring the OS, specific configurations and optimizations are recommended.